1) If you request a glass of water at a restaurant - is it tap water or something that I can drink? ( Sorry Mickey but Florida tapwater is yukky!:sick: )
If you request plain water you will receive tap water.

2) My hubby is a HUGE ice tea drinker and prefers his tea unsweetened with lemon ( if available) - is Florida ice tea "sweet tea" or is it just like suntea?
WDW ice tea for the most part is a Nestea unsweetened concoction. It is not very good or clean tasting in my opinion. It is not fresh brewed as in suntea. It is an instant mix, usually made with hot water to dissolve the cyrstals/mix. It is unsweetened, and lemon is redily available. It is not sweet tea, although sweet tea is available at select locations.

I am a huge tea drinker and after about 3 days out of a 10 day trip in June, I swore it off.
